Output 23ba1af6603ec8dc1e24d5c94f85058d9e1a3af6e913eac77d249365f28f97d7:0

value
3047591
script pubkey
OP_0 OP_PUSHBYTES_20 d73d7bfbb276b77cc38dacadffd1e50954e89501
address
bc1q6u7hh7ajw6mhesud4jkll509p92w39gpkpn06w
transaction
23ba1af6603ec8dc1e24d5c94f85058d9e1a3af6e913eac77d249365f28f97d7
spent
true